Services for Bessie Mae Stout were held Jan. 24 in the chapel of the John W. German Funeral Home in Hayti with the Rev. Charles Smith officiating. Mrs. Stout died Jan. 20, 1982, in Owosso, Mich. She was 85.
Mrs. Stout was born in Fairfield, Ill., on Oct. 11, 1896. In 1912 she married Edgar Stout in Tyler. He and three children preceded her in death.
Surviving are six sons, C.W. of Hayti, Edward of Burton, Mich., Hoyt of Mt. Victory, Ohio, Billy of Flushing, Mich., Ralph of Owosso, and Robert of West Liberty, Ky.; three daughters, Mrs. Hazel Archileta of Fairfield, Calif., and Mrs. Emogene Crevison and Mrs. Neoma Odom of Phoenix; and 42 grandchildren, 54 great-grandchildren, and five great-great-grandchildren.
Interment was in the Mt. Zion Cemetery in Steele.
Pemiscot Journal - Caruthersville, Missouri - February 2, 1982
